Proposed Development

PROTECTED STRUCTURE, RETENTION & PERMISSION: Retention permission for development consisting of 1. Alterations to the rear roof slope to accommodate dormer access stairs to the attic with garden facing window, floor area of 15.6 metres squared, 2. Additional single storey rear garden extension with garden facing windows and rooflight, floor area of 15 metres squared. The above were both completed circa 1996 in connection with permission Ref: 1916/94. They further apply for Permission for 3. Hacking off cementitious render to the front facade, raking out, repair and re-pointing of historic brickwork. 4 To reinstate historic profile sash windows in lieu of existing PVC framed windows. All at 14 Marlborough Road, Dublin 4 (a Protected Structure).
